Kelvin Floodlight Dinner Plate Dahlias - 2 Bulbs


A Beacon of Sunny Yellow in your garden! The Kelvin Floodlight dahlia is a true showstopper, known for its radiant sunshine yellow blooms and impressive size. Flowers reach up to 10 inches wide!

  • Light: Full sun
  • Blooms: Summer to fall
  • Mature Height: 36-48 inches
  • Planting instructions: Easy to grow in moist, fertile soil in full sun. Water well during the growing season, especially when grown in containers. Dahlias do not tolerate frost and should not be planted if there is a chance that the shoots will freeze.
  • Additional Notes: Pinch excess buds and deadhead to encourage additional, larger blooms. After the stalks are killed by frost, remove them, leaving a 6-inch stub. Leave the roots in the ground for two weeks to thoroughly ripen before digging them. Dig carefully so the roots do not break away from the clump, which results in blind roots. (A blind root has no eye and therefore cannot produce a shoot.) Dry the roots enough to shake the soil from them, then pack in sawdust, perlite, or vermiculite, and store in a cool, dry place until spring.
  • Attributes: Attracts butterflies & hummingbirds, beautiful cut flower, perfect for containers
